Lake Luco – Laugen Spitze – Monte Luco loop from Gampenpass - Passo delle Palade

06:31

13.9km

1,000m

Hiking

Hard hike. Very good fitness required. Mostly accessible paths. Sure-footedness required.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Today was a tour on the Grosse Laugen, the highest mountain in the Nonsberg group, on the program. The starting point was the parking lot on the Gampenpass, where a bunker from the Second World War could also be viewed. From there it went steeply uphill on roots and wooden stairs through the forest (path no. 133, Bonacossa Steig). We …

The way from the Großer Laugen to the Laugen Alm is poorly signposted. Stay on path 10A or 10. After the wonderful picnic area, we followed a very bad path, rather a path mentioned that has not been maintained for a long time.
